你查询的IP:[203.90.91.103]  地理位置:印度

最新查询203.90.83.207 58.66.65.81 118.212.229.99 124.40.128.226 123.177.249.41 202.120.6.79 116.2.83.201 117.32.73.204 123.232.175.78 203.90.91.103 218.164.239.244 203.93.221.98 210.2.213.154 117.57.127.147 60.232.251.135 211.160.218.184 202.91.128.99 221.196.5.36 202.38.138.179 122.198.97.116 221.198.81.6 202.74.8.35 61.47.128.82 114.28.164.69 117.48.94.228 125.62.33.52 117.103.16.117 121.40.109.107 116.214.64.248 202.127.160.96 123.232.43.121